### Escalation — Sweepster Orphan Cleanup

If Sweepster flags more than 500 orphaned volumes in one pass, don't panic — it's usually a stale tag filter, not an actual leak. Pause the sweep with `sweepster halt`, snapshot the candidate list, and ping the infra channel. If the list includes anything tagged `release-locked`, that's a hard stop: nothing gets deleted until the Calderon Cloud platform leads sign off. For sign-off requests or anything you can't untangle within an hour, email the sweeper owners.

alerts address for kafog-haweg: wendor.ulaael@zemvarworks.internal

## Who to ping about GiftNote

Welcome aboard! GiftNote is our donation-receipt mailer for the Larchfield Fund. Template tweaks go to the comms folks; delivery failures and bounce weirdness go to the platform crew. Don't push template changes on Fridays — receipts batch over the weekend. For anything GiftNote-related, start with the address below.

billing contact of kaweg-tajeg = drudor.lamion.oliath@torvalabs.test

// Broker upgrade notes for plugin authors:
// Quillbus 4.x replaces the legacy 3.x wire protocol. Plugins must
// construct the client with explicit protocol negotiation enabled,
// or connections to the Larkfield cluster will be silently downgraded
// and dropped after 30s. Topic names are unchanged. For local testing
// against the sandbox broker, authenticate with the key below.

API key for bafof-bagaf: qvz2-qi